Why is I-PAC making Jogaiah letter viral?

Why is I-PAC making Jogaiah letter viral?

The open letter written by veteran Kapu leader and former Lok Sabha member Chegondi Harirama Jogaiah to the Kapu community, attacking power star and Jana Sena Party Pawan Kalyan for surrendering to the Telugu Desam Party led by former Andhra Pradesh chief minister N Chandrababu Naidu has created ripples in the political circles.

What is interesting is that the letter was being widely circulated in the mainstream and social media by Indian Political Action Committee (I-PAC), the political consultants engaged by YSR Congress party headed by chief minister Y S Jagan Mohan Reddy.

The contents of the letter, which are in Telugu, have been translated into English and are being circulated on social media by the I-PAC team, along with its own comments stating that Pawan Kalyan had proved to be a package star for the TDP.

“Jogaiah has cautioned Kapus in Andhra and expressed doubt that Pawan Kalyan May merge Jana Sena Party into TDP. He said looking at the developments, the allegations by other parties of the package seem to be true,” the I-PAC posts on social media said.

One wonders why I-PAC is making the letter written by Jogaiah viral on social media, as it is purely an issue between him and the Jana Sena Party chief.

Obviously, the I-PAC, which is working for the YSRC, wants to prove that Pawan is a betrayer of Kapu community and his own community leaders like Jogaiah are questioning his silence to the statement of  TDP general secretary Nara Lokesh that his father N Chandrababu Naidu would be the chief minister for next five years.

There is also a talk that the involvement of I-PAC in the episode could be part of the strategy of YSRC to lure Jogaiah into the party.

For, Jogaiah has never opposed the TDP-Jana Sena Party alliance and in fact, he even welcomed the alliance saying it is the only way to defeat the YSRC in the next elections.

Very recently, he had even submitted his own recommendations on the Kapu community to Jana Sena Party leader Nadendla Manohar and requested him to incorporate them in the common manifesto of the TDP and Jana Sena.

Jogaiah is not a political novice to expect that Pawan Kalyan would become the chief minister of the TDP-Jana Sena government, as he is very much aware Jana Sena would be a minor partner of the TDP.

“So, the ex-MP knows Pawan Kalyan can never become the CM. But now, he suddenly changed his tune and started alleging that Pawan is sold out to Naidu. It is pretty evident that he has come under the influence of the YSRC,” a TDP leader said.
